How much does it cost to rent a home in Logan Park?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Logan Park 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,542 | $1,495 | $3,650 |
Logan Park 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,187 | $1,699 | $3,300 |
Logan Park 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,228 | $2,140 | $4,995 |
Logan Park 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,948 | $2,495 | $3,250 |
Logan Park 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,600 | $4,600 | $4,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Logan Park
What type of rentals are currently available in Logan Park?
There are currently 688 Apartments for Rent in Logan Park, MN with pricing that ranges from $479 to $12,371. There are also 88 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Logan Park ranging from $1,395 to $4,995.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Logan Park?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Logan Park ranges from $1,395 to $4,995 with an average monthly rent of $2,732.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Logan Park?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Logan Park range from $495 to $12,371,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,699 to $3,300.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,140 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$495.
